            Kodiak is 0-5 against Juneau-Douglas since December of 2014 but things could change  on Friday. The Kodiak Bears will welcome the Juneau-Douglas Crimson Bears  at 6:00  p.m. Both teams took a loss in their last game, so they'll have plenty of motivation to get the 'W'.
Kodiak is headed into Friday's   game looking for a big change in momentum after dropping their fourth straight game  on Saturday. They took  a  49-38 hit to the loss column at the hands of Wasilla.
 The loss doesn't tell the whole story though, as several players had good games. One of the most active was  Kelly Ticman, who  posted nine points.  Mac Abellera was another key player,  putting up seven  points.
 Meanwhile, Juneau-Douglas was not able to break out of their rough patch  on Saturday as the team picked up their sixth straight  loss. They came up short against  Mt. Edgecumbe, falling  68-47. The Crimson Bears were in a tough position after the first half, with the score already sitting at  38-11.
 Kodiak's defeat dropped their record down to 2-9. As for Juneau-Douglas, their loss dropped their record down to 5-12.
 Kodiak suffered a grim  75-50 defeat to Juneau-Douglas  in their previous meeting  back in February of 2024. That  matchup was all but decided by halftime, at which point Kodiak was down  37-17.
